Reports: Rangers G Igor Shesterkin agrees to record $92M deal
New York Rangers goaltender Igor Shesterkin agreed to a record-setting eight-year, $92 million contract on Friday, according to multiple reports.,Shesterkin's deal, which averages $11.5 million annually and runs through the 2032-33 season, is the largest ever for a goaltender. Rangers trade captain Jacob Trouba to Ducks
The New York Rangers traded captain Jacob Trouba to the Anaheim Ducks on Friday in exchange for defenseman Urho Vaakanainen and a conditional fourth-round pick in the 2025 NHL Draft.,The Ducks will take on the full remaining salary for Trouba, the veteran defenseman who had fallen out of favor in Ne...

Dash re-sign M Kiki Van Zanten through 2026 season
The Houston Dash re-signed midfielder Kiki Van Zanten to a two-year contract on Friday.,The new deal runs through the 2026 NWSL season and includes a mutual option for 2027.,Van Zanten, 23, played in four matches (one start) before sustaining a season-ending foot injury in April.,The Dash selected V...
